How To Keep Pipes From Freezing In Cold Weather
How to Prevent Pipes From Freezing Disconnect outside water hoses. “If left connected, water in the hoses will freeze and expand, causing outside faucets and connecting pipes inside your home to freeze and break,” warned the experts at Roto-Rooter. Disconnect all outdoor hoses, and use a faucet cover ($5, HomeDepot.com) to keep outside faucets from freezing. Let the water run overnight. It sounds wasteful, but leaving a gentle trickle of hot and cold water running from a sink or bathtub faucet can prevent pipes from bursting on the coldest nights....
